Pre-screening techniques for identification of samples suitable for radiocarbon dating of poorly preserved bones
Under certain environmental conditions, post-depositional diagenetic loss of bone collagen can severely reduce the number of bones from a particular archaeological site that are suitable for stable isotopic analysis or radiocarbon dating.
